THE R.M.S.S. TAINUI.
At 7 a.m. yesterday the Shaw, Savill and Albion Company's R.M. a.s. Tainui, Capfc. B. J. Barlow, arrived in port from England, via ports of call en route, and Auckland and Wellington. She was moored to the ocean steamers' wharf, where she completes her loading for London, and sails direct on Thursday next. She has no cargo to land here. At northern ports she received 13,000 carcases of mutton, and 1200 pieces of beef, besides a quantity of other produce.
